What I Check Before Buying
Before I commit, I always check a few important things:
- CPU compatibility: I make sure the board matches the processor I plan to use.
- RAM support: I confirm the memory speed and capacity I want are supported.
- Case fit: I verify that my PC case can handle the motherboard size.
- Cooling needs: I look at how much airflow and cooling the system will need.
- Storage options: I review how many SSDs and drives I can install.
- Connectivity: I check for USB, networking, and wireless features I will actually use.
